12 impactful news stories in 2025

SANTO DOMINGO– The construction, real estate, and tourism sectors experienced an intense 2025 with events that shook society. Some had a positive impact, others transcended borders because they allegedly sought to bring order, while some, like the collapse of the Jet Set, became part of the sad chapters of recent Dominican history. We reproduce 12 impactful events experienced by the country in 2025, originally published in El Inmobiliario :

Economy grew 5%

In 2024, the country achieved a Gross Domestic Product (GDP) growth of 5.0%, establishing itself as a regional leader, as reported earlier this year by the Central Bank of the Dominican Republic.

Cheetah

In February, the Public Prosecutor's Office dismantled a network allegedly dedicated to selling nonexistent properties through Novasco Real Estate, affecting more than 130 people and defrauding them of approximately US$18 million. Several people have been charged in connection with the case and are currently under pretrial detention.

Giant investment

Alex Rodriguez, former Major League Baseball star, announced alongside David Collado, Minister of Tourism, an investment that will exceed one billion dollars and will add around 600 rooms between villas and high-end apartments in Rio San Juan.

Jet Set

On April 8, the roof of the iconic Jet Set nightclub collapsed, killing 233 people and injuring around 200. The collapse occurred while merengue singer Rubby Pérez, who died in the collapse, was performing at the club's traditional Monday night party.

Supplier Registration

The executive director of Pro Consumidor, Eddy Alcántara, announced in May the creation of a real estate provider registry that will seek to eradicate scams in real estate transactions in the country.

Republic of Colombia

In July, the Government presented the project “Road and Environmental Solution: Republic of Colombia Avenue and its surroundings”, an intervention that will be carried out in an estimated period of 24 months, with an investment that will exceed RD$9,000 million.

New Penal Code

The Executive Branch enacted the new Penal Code on August 3, which replaces the legal regime that had been in place since 1884, and which will begin to be applied from August 2026.

Baní Ring Road

With an investment of 7.7 billion pesos, the Government inaugurated the Baní Bypass in July, in the province of Peravia, with a length of 19.8 kilometers and 17 bridges.

Work stoppage

In September, the Ministry of Labor reported the suspension of 15 construction projects due to a lack of safety and health conditions that endangered the physical integrity of the workers.

New Mivhed rates

The Ministry of Housing, Habitat and Buildings (Mivhed) announced in August new adjustments to the fees for processing plans and inspecting private buildings.

Rental law

In mid-August, the Executive Branch enacted Law 85-25 on Real Estate Rentals and Evictions.

Chinese shops

Mivehd closed more than 10 Chinese-owned stores in September due to violations of building regulations.
